Hey everyone, I'm relatively new to Crystal and need some help. I've created a report in Crystal XI, that looks like:
Month 1
VENDOR PO # Date Ordered Date Recd Workdays
Acme 1234 01/12/2008 03/12/2008 2
The idea being to be able to measure supplier lead times.
I then decided we could take it a step further and compare Month 1 with Month 2 and Month 3, so we could not only measure lead times, but compare lead times for suppliers over three monthly periods. Months are parameter fields where I can specify start/end dates for the month I wish to compare.
Using this first report, I created a sub report and linked the Vendor Name fields together, and although the sub report prints the report headers, there's no detail on the report.
Essentially, the report will be an extended version of the sample above:
Supplier Month 1 Month 2 Month 3
Does this make sense? I just can't get any detail to print on the sub report. All it needs to do is match the vendor name on the first report, with the purchase order information from the sub report....am I on the right track, or have I completely messed it up?
